Position Summary

VueStay Vacations by Casago is seeking a Controller or Vice President of Finance to build, strengthen, and scale the financial backbone of a rapidly growing, multi-market vacation rental platform. This is a hands-on finance & accounting role for a disciplined, rigorous professional who thrives in environments where structure needs to be built, processes need to be refined, and financial clarity is essential to smart decision-making. You will take ownership of the finance and accounting function, stabilize and professionalize core accounting operations, oversee outsourced accounting resources, and create the reporting infrastructure needed to support a fast-moving hospitality business with an active M&A pipeline.

The right candidate brings a sharp analytical mind, strong technical depth, and a practical approach to execution. You’ll partner closely with operations to ensure financial processes reflect the realities of the business, while producing accurate reporting, stronger controls, and meaningful performance insights for leadership. Over time, this role will expand beyond accounting oversight into broader strategic finance leadership, making it an ideal opportunity for someone who enjoys solving complex problems, improving systems, and building a finance function that can scale with confidence.

Key Responsibilities

  • Have a key leadership role in the Finance & Accounting function, including oversight of accounting personnel and external partners, ensuring accuracy, timeliness, and quality of deliverables

  • Review financial statements, journal entries, and reconciliations to ensure GAAP compliance and audit readiness

  • Establish and improve close processes, internal controls, and accounting policies to support a scalable, multi-entity environment

  • Listen to operational leaders across markets to understand drivers and help translate them into financials and actionable insights

  • Develop and maintain monthly reporting packages, including variance analyses and tracking of key performance indicators

  • Support budgeting, forecasting, and cash management processes

  • Evaluate and enhance financial systems and tools, including ERP optimization and integration

  • Play a key role in M&A activity, including post-close integration of acquired businesses' Finance & Accounting functions, partnering closely with the Director of Integration to standardize processes, systems, and reporting across entities

  • Build and scale the internal finance team over time, including hiring and developing key roles

  • Support leadership with financial analysis and insights
